That evening, Oscar, Lily the Sprite, and Elro search through the summary journals on Unzadzir and Yenelas, looking for hints about Naomis the Cave Goddess, whose prime follower is somewhere in the city. In the journal for Yenelas, they find a passage recorded by one Jarin Darkdraft, a seeker from the College of Lanterns who found ancient writings to a goddess not mentioned anywhere else. Uncertain, they decide to visit Creios's library and compare the drawings copies from this journal to research about the imprisoned gods. The next morning, Neeral goes to report to Captain McKinnon on the strange new cult they are tracking, while Oscar uses his animal forms to try sneaking the books back into the records building. Despite run-ins with a cat (when he was a centipede) and some researchers (when he was a cat), he manages to leave the books behind, politely tied together with a blue ribbon he found in his pocket. After regrouping over breakfast, the party sets off toward Creios's clock tower. On the way, they are ambushed by four assailants wearing nondescript gray plaster masks, who attack them with oil and fire before attempting to retreat. Neeral knocks two out, while J.J. asks Lily to trail a third. Oscar and Elro ensnare the fourth with magic, but then Oscar, responding to the god's voice coming from his spear, executes the captured attacker with his new spear and is invigorated. Searching the two dead and one captured attackers, they discover odd pieces of shale, on which are scratched a symbol. Each attacker carried two, one enchanted to track the amulet Neeral is wearing, taken from the neck of Zonlos the Chosen of Ayk, and the other apparently mundane. On top of that, each attacker carried credentials as a member of the College of Lanterns. Neeral and J.J. take the prisoner back to the guard headquarters and report to the captain, while Oscar and Elro continue on to the clock tower. Though Creios is out, his assistant helps the druid and wizard find a record of the holy symbols of each of the imprisoned gods. There, they confirm that the symbols found by Jarin Darkdraft were related to Naomis, and additionally note that the symbol scratched into the piece of shale matches that same symbol. As a point of interest, they research the types of magic and general dispositions of Naomis and Ayk, and discover that Naomis was associated with secrets and illusion, while Ayk was associated with dynamic individuals and berzerkers. Oscar is disquieted by the knowledge, suspecting as he does that Ayk has a direct line on his brain. Meanwhile, McKinnon has accepted the prisoner, secured the amulet that the cultists were tracking in a lead-lined box, with plans to lock it up in a special magic-proof vault at the earliest opportunity, and planned to put the city Arcanists on alert for unusual magical activity, while sending mundane investigators to check out the College of Lanterns, seeing as it was a common connection between all the attackers. Neeral and J.J. leave with a promise that they will be informed if anything comes up. On the way out, J.J. overhears the captain telling her assistant to prepare a message for "Master Darkdraft" that investigators will need access to his school. The party then regroups to plan. Lily reports back that the attacker she tracked removed his mask and wandered erratically before eventually returning to the College's dormitory. J.J. repeated what he had overheard to the rest of them, and together they hatched a plan. Lily would invisibly watch the College, ready to report anything they tried to hide before the investigators would arrive. Neeral would request to be included on the investigation team, while J.J. waited near campus where Lily could contact him quickly if it became necessary. Oscar would refresh his animal forms before sneaking onto campus in beastly disguise and Elro reviewed his knowledge of magic, preparing himself for the challenges he expected to face within. Their plans were cut short in execution when the city became agitated. A great barrier, seemingly formed of translucent smoke but impervious to physical or magical entry, had formed around the College's campus. J.J. lost contact with Lily, the only one of the group who had made it inside before the barrier went up. The rest of them now must discover a way inside, both to answer their remaining questions and to rescue the lost Sprite.
